Shiny peach polish on elegant, tapered fingers
Faint fragrance of rose mixed with Jergen’s
I loved your creamy white hands, Grandmother
I’d lay alongside you as you napped, put my fingertips next to yours
Watch the rise and fall of your chest, feel the warmth of your breath
Fall into a peaceful sleep that felt like being carried on a breeze
I’ve never felt as safe and loved as I did then
You’ve been gone so long, but I can find you whenever I want
I just put on some Jergen’s and close my eyes
